Technical Analysis

The Quick Playground WordPress plugin version 1.3.1 and earlier is vulnerable to unauthenticated remote code execution (RCE). This vulnerability allows attackers to execute arbitrary code remotely without requiring authentication, potentially leading to full system compromise. The exploit targets WordPress environments running this plugin, including setups with Docker, Debian, Apache, PHP 8.2, and WordPress 6.x. No patch or official remediation guidance is currently available from the vendor or other authoritative sources.

Potential Impact

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ability can lead to complete compromise of the affected WordPress site and underlying server. Attackers can execute arbitrary code remotely without authentication, which may result in data theft, site defacement, malware installation, or further network pivoting. Given the unauthenticated nature of the flaw, the risk is critical.

Mitigation Recommendations

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Until a patch is available, it is recommended to disable or remove the Quick Playground plugin version 1.3.1 or earlier to prevent exploitation. Monitor official vendor channels for updates and apply patches promptly once released.
